Recherche sur les Noms des fonctions php/mysql
htmlspecialchars_decode()
Définition
- (PHP 5 >= 5.1.0)Description
string htmlspecialchars_decode
( string $string
[, int $quote_style
] )
Cette fonction est l'opposée de htmlspecialchars(). Elle convertit les entités HTML spéciales en caractères.
Les entités converties sont : &, " (lorsque ENT_NOQUOTES n'est pas activée), ' (lorsque ENT_NOQUOTES est activée), < et >.
Liste de paramètres
- string
-
La chaîne de caractères à décoder
- quote_style
-
Le style de guillemets. Une des constantes suivantes :
Constantes quote_style Nom de la Constante Description ENT_COMPAT Convertira les guillemets et laissera les apostrophes (valeur par défaut) ENT_QUOTES Convertira les guillemets et les apostrophes ENT_NOQUOTES Laissera les guillemets et les apostrophes non convertis
Valeurs de retour
Retourne la chaîne de caractères décodée.
Exemples
Exemple #1 Exemple avec htmlspecialchars_decode()
<?php
$str = '<p>this -> "</p>';
echo htmlspecialchars_decode($str);
// notez ici que les guillemets ne sont pas convertis
echo htmlspecialchars_decode($str, ENT_NOQUOTES);
?>
L'exemple ci-dessus va afficher :
<p>this -> "</p> <p>this -> "</p>
Bouts de code utilisant la fonction htmlspecialchars_decode()
<?php /* ... */
// phase 4
$this->cur_url = htmlspecialchars_decode($matches[1]);
$this->my_curl_setopt(CURLOPT_URL, $this->cur_url);
/* ... */ ?>
<?php /* ... */
$match )) {
$url = htmlspecialchars_decode($match[1]);
my_curl_setopt(CURLOPT_URL, $url);
/* ... */ ?>
Connexion
Les fonctions
Références
- addcslashes
- addslashes
- bin2hex
- chop
- chr
- chunk_split
- convert_cyr_string
- convert_uudecode
- convert_uuencode
- count_chars
- crc32
- crypt
- echo
- explode
- fprintf
- get_html_translation_table...
- hebrev
- hebrevc
- html_entity_decode
- htmlentities
- htmlspecialchars_decode...
- htmlspecialchars
- implode
- join
- levenshtein
- localeconv
- ltrim
- md5_file
- md5
- metaphone
- money_format
- nl_langinfo
- nl2br
- number_format
- ord
- parse_str
- printf
- quoted_printable_decode...
- quotemeta
- rtrim
- setlocale
- sha1_file
- sha1
- similar_text
- soundex
- sprintf
- sscanf
- str_getcsv
- str_ireplace
- str_pad
- str_repeat
- str_replace
- str_rot13
- str_shuffle
- str_split
- str_word_count
- strcasecmp
- strchr
- strcmp
- strcoll
- strcspn
- strip_tags
- stripcslashes
- stripos
- stripslashes
- stristr
- strlen
- strnatcasecmp
- strnatcmp
- strncasecmp
- strncmp
- strpbrk
- strpos
- strrchr
- strrev
- strripos
- strrpos
- strspn
- strstr
- strtok
- strtolower
- strtoupper
- strtr
- substr_compare
- substr_count
- substr_replace
- substr
- trim
- ucfirst
- ucwords
- vfprintf
- vprintf
- vsprintf





